How does it work?Microdata markup w/ schema.org
Basic Format!
schema.org is a taxonomy
View the taxonomy at schema.org/Thing
HTML5 allows us to point elements on our pages to the schema.org taxonomy
Basic FormatGetting Started With Schema.Org
Use <div> and <span> to markup elements (div is for blocks of text, span for small inline items.)
itemscope: “This is an item.”
itemtype: “This is what type of item is is.”
itemprop: “This item has the following property.”
Example: (Before)<div>
<h1>Avatar</h1>
<span>Director: James Cameron (born August 16, 1954)</span>
<span>Science fiction</span>
<a href="../movies/avatar-theatrical-trailer.html">Trailer</a>
</div>
Example: (itemscope)<div itemscope>
<h1>Avatar</h1>
<span>Director: James Cameron (born August 16, 1954)</span>
<span>Science fiction</span>
<a href="../movies/avatar-theatrical-trailer.html">Trailer</a>
</div>
Example: (itemtype)<div itemscope itemtype="http://schema.org/Movie">
<h1>Avatar</h1>
<span>Director: James Cameron (born August 16, 1954)</span>
<span>Science fiction</span>
<a href="../movies/avatar-theatrical-trailer.html">Trailer</a>
</div>
Example: (itemprop)<div itemscope itemtype="http://schema.org/Movie">
<h1 itemprop=“name”>Avatar</h1>
<span>Director: James Cameron (born August 16, 1954)</span>
<span>Science fiction</span>
<a href="../movies/avatar-theatrical-trailer.html">Trailer</a>
</div>
Example: (itemprop)<div itemscope itemtype="http://schema.org/Movie">
<h1 itemprop=“name”>Avatar</h1>
<span>Director: <span itemprop=“director”>James Cameron</span> (born August 16, 1954)</span>
<span itemprop=“genre”>Science fiction</span>
<a href=“../movies/avatar-theatrical-trailer.html” itemprop=“trailer"> Trailer</a>
</div>
Example: (embeded)
Before:
<span>Director: <span itemprop=“director”>James Cameron</span> (born August 16, 1954)</span>
After embedding another itemscope:
<div itemprop="director" itemscope itemtype=“http://schema.org/Person"> Director: <span itemprop="name">James Cameron</span> (born <span itemprop="birthDate">August 16, 1954)</span> </div>
Example: (Before)<div>
<h1>Avatar</h1>
<span>Director: James Cameron (born August 16, 1954)</span>
<span>Science fiction</span>
<a href="../movies/avatar-theatrical-trailer.html">Trailer</a>
</div>
Example: (After)<div itemscope itemtype ="http://schema.org/Movie">
<h1 itemprop="name">Avatar</h1>
<div itemprop="director" itemscope itemtype="http://schema.org/ Person">Director: <span itemprop="name">James Cameron</span> (born <span itemprop=“birthDate">August 16, 1954)</span> </div>
<span itemprop="genre">Science fiction</span>
<a href="../movies/avatar-theatrical-trailer.html" itemprop="trailer">Trailer</a>
</div>
